Pueblo School District 60

Pueblo School District 60 (D60), formerly Pueblo City Schools, is a school district serving Pueblo, Colorado. Its headquarters, the Administrative Services Center, are in Pueblo.

History
It was formed on March 4, 1946, with the consolidation of Pueblo School District 1 and Pueblo School District 20 to form Pueblo School District 60. It was known as Pueblo City Schools from 2006 until it reverted to its original name in August 2019. ==Schools==

Other facilities
The Orman-Adams Mansion, now a private residence, was used by the school district from 1952 until 1979; the district used it for office space. ==References==
